Silvia Mercedes Calderon

November 30, 1940 — December 26, 2020

Silvia Mercedes Calderon at the age of 80 years old, transitioned to be with our Lord on December 26, 2020. She was born on the beautiful island of Puerto Rico in a town named Mayaguez. She was the daughter of Mercedes Rosado and Marcos Rosado. At the age of 8 years old, Silvia relocated with her family to New York City where she resided on East 118th Street. There, she immersed herself in the arts. She studied ballet and in high school won 1st place in a drawing contest.
Mrs. Calderon was a wife and mother. During her lifetime, she was a homemaker, a valued member of her children’s school’s PTA and a den mother for her cub scouts’ troupe. There she met and fell in love with her late husband Joseph Calderon. She resided in New York for most of her life until her family relocated to Valdosta, Georgia.
Mrs. Calderon moved to Valdosta, Georgia on September 8, 2006. She loved nature and loved Valdosta. She was inspired to capture its natural beauty and wildlife in her acrylic paintings. She was an accomplished artist. In addition to her artistic talents, Mrs. Calderon loved to cook especially traditional Puerto Rican meals. She was a fantastic cook. She enjoyed cooking for her family and teaching them how to cook these traditional meals. Silvia was very proud of her Puerto Rican culture and that was evident in her paintings as well. She enjoyed laughing and speaking with family. Mrs. Calderon was a devoted catholic. As the matriarch of her family; she will truly be missed.
